Cintra","submitted_at":"2018-06-20T18:35:02Z","abstract_excerpt":"In this paper we introduce the class of beta seasonal autoregressive moving average ($\\beta$SARMA) models for modeling and forecasting time series data that assume values in the standard unit interval. It generalizes the class of beta autoregressive moving average models [Rocha and Cribari-Neto, Test, 2009] by incorporating seasonal dynamics to the model dynamic structure. Besides introducing the new class of models, we develop parameter estimation, hypothesis testing inference, and diagnostic analysis tools. We also discuss out-of-sample forecasting.
